How they compare

Bolivia currently reports 65.0% against 64.9% in New Zealand, a difference of 0.1%.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was New Zealand ahead.

Bolivia ranks 120th and New Zealand ranks 121st of 218 countries.

New Zealand has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bolivia New Zealand Difference Ahead
1960s 54.4% 59.5% 5.1% New Zealand
1970s 54.4% 61.6% 7.3% New Zealand
1980s 55.0% 65.5% 10.5% New Zealand
1990s 56.0% 66.0% 10.0% New Zealand
2000s 58.5% 66.3% 7.8% New Zealand
2010s 61.7% 65.7% 3.9% New Zealand
2020s 64.3% 65.2% 0.9% New Zealand

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
